Why do i need to use a credit card as a deposit method for FBA

1. How will the money be transferred to my credit card

2. Am I meant to make some kind of payments with the credit card

3. For what reasons can I not use a debit card instead (I'm aware you can use a debit card but not all of them will work, I'm asking to know what reasons are behind not being able to use certain cards)

The credit card is not for a deposit method, it's a verification step to list/sell on Amazon.

" Am I meant to make some kind of payments with the credit card [?]"

Amazon will charge your valid credit card for any fees that exceed your sales.

Credit cards are a much more reliable way for Amazon to collect what is owed than debit cards.

1. How will the money be transferred to my credit card
View post

It won't. Money will be transferred to your bank account on file. This may or may not be the same bank as your CC.

user profile
Seller_wKLqJdeAT0IFH
2. Am I meant to make some kind of payments with the credit card
View post

Normally? No. As a backup in case your sales revenue does not cover costs? Yes.

user profile
Seller_wKLqJdeAT0IFH
3. For what reasons can I not use a debit card instead
View post

Two good explanations. First of all, a true CC is a more reliable method for Amazon to be sure of getting money from you if your sales do not cover expenses.

As a second reason, requiring you to have a CC is a quick and easy way for Amazon to verify that, at least to someone, you have valid credit. Easier than running credit checks on everyone.

Steve from Amazon here, thank you for the questions. There are two main methods that must be active in order to have full access to to list items. A bank account as a deposit method, this is used to receive payments from Amazon, and a Credit Card which is the charge method used to pay fees and other charges that may occur.

It is important to check the below information related to your credit card.

  • Is the credit card valid?
  • Is there a minimum charge amount?
  • Are you using a pre-paid card? (Note: Use of a pre-paid card is not accepted for a selling account.)
  • Does the bank have a record of the charge attempt?
  • Are there bank limits or policies that prevent the charge attempt from being authorized?
  • Is there any incorrect credit card information entered? (Note: All the credit card information entered such as number, name, address, ZIP code, or expiration date must be an exact match with your card details.)
  • Is this chargeable in the currency of the Amazon marketplace where you registered your seller account?
